HON'BLE SRI JUSTICE V.RAMASUBRAMANIAN Civil Revision Petition No.716 of 2018 along with I.A.No.1/2018 in CRP No.4405/2017 Order:

Both revisions are between the same parties. C.R.P. No.4405 of 2017 was already disposed of by a common order passed on 22-12-2017, allowing the prayer therein. But while doing so, a direction was issued to the First Appellate Court to dispose of the appeal A.S.No.45 of 2015 within six weeks.

2. It is contended that the Principal District Court, Krishna has already passed an order in Transfer O.P.No.1 of 2016 directing the withdrawal of three other connected suits and the transfer of the same to the same Court where the appeal is pending for joint disposal. Therefore, in order to synchronise the pre-existing order of the Principal District Court dated 01-4-2016 with the order passed by this Court in C.R.P.No.4405 of 2017, the petitioner has come up - (a) I.A.No.1 of 2018 for clarifying the order passed by this Court and (b) a civil revision in C.R.P.No.716 of 2018 challenging the order passed in Transfer O.P. No.1 of 2016.

3. Heard Mr. S.Satyanarayana Prasad, learned Senior Counsel appearing for the petitioner and Mr. A.P. Venugopal, learned counsel appearing for the respondent.

4. It is stated by Mr. A.P. Venugopal, learned counsel appearing for the landlord, that all the three suits viz., O.S.Nos.130 of 2011, 233 of 2015 and 491 of 2015, have all

become infructuous, that memos have already been filed and that therefore nothing remains to be adjudicated. In other words, the only lis now pending is A.S.No.45 of 2015.

5. Therefore, C.R.P.No.716 of 2018 and I.A.No.1 of 2018 in C.R.P.No.4405 of 2017 are disposed of directing the First Appellate Court to dispose of A.S.No.45 of 2015 independently. The miscellaneous petitions, if any, pending in the revision shall stand closed. No costs.
